Oostermeenthe is located in the province of Overijssel, in the municipality of Steenwijkerland, in the district Steenwijk The neighbourhood has a total area of 79 hectares, of which 77 hectares are land and 2 hectares are water. The neighbourhood is coded as BU17080009. The postcode area is 8332AC-8332JD.

Residents

Oostermeenthe has 2.965 residents. Of these, 48,7% are men and 51,3% are women. Most residents are 45 to 65 years (24,8%). The other age groups are 23,9% for '25 to 45 years', 21,2% for '65 years or older', 17,5% for '0 to 15 years' and 12,6% for '15 to 25 years'. Of the residents, 44,7% is unmarried, 41,3% is married, 8,6% is divorced and 5,6% is widowed. 2.485 residents originate from the Netherlands, 105 come from Europe and 375 come from countries outside Europe.

There are 1.265 households in Oostermeenthe. 29,6% of these are single-person households, 31,2% households without children and 39,1% households with children. The average household size is 2,3 persons.

In Oostermeenthe there are 2.400 income recipients. The average income per income recipient is €27.900, which is €7.900 (22%) lower than the national average of €35.800. Per resident, the average income is €23.800, which is €5.400 (18%) lower than the national average of €29.200. Most residents of Oostermeenthe are educated to an intermediate level. 50,7% have an intermediate education (HAVO, VWO or MBO 2-4), 29,2% have a lower education (VMBO or MBO 1) and 20,1% have a university or higher professional education (HBO/WO).

Of the 2.965 residents, around 65% are in paid employment, which amounts to 1.927 people. This is 0% lower than the national average of 65%. The majority of workers are in salaried employment (90%), while 10% are self-employed. In Oostermeenthe, 27% of residents receive a benefit. The largest group is those receiving a state pension (AOW). 570 people receive this benefit.

Housing

In Oostermeenthe there are 1.340 homes with an average assessed value (WOZ) of €224.000. Of these, around 93% are occupied and 7% unoccupied. Most homes are owner-occupied. This amounts to 39% rental homes and 61% owner-occupied homes. Of the homes, 61% privately owned, 30% owned by housing associations and 9% owned by other landlords. The most common construction periods in Oostermeenthe are 1970-1980 (90%) and 2010-2020 (7%).

Energy

In Oostermeenthe there are 1.345 addresses with a registered energy label. The most common labels are C (66%), D (17%) and B (6%). On average, an address in Oostermeenthe uses 2.580 kWh of electricity per year. This is 8% below the national average of 2.810 kWh. With an annual consumption of 1.120 m³ per address, natural gas consumption is 13% below the national average of 1.280 m³.
